Why Hot Dip Galvanized Brackets?
Think of these brackets as the backbone of any solar setup. Unlike standard coatings, hot dip galvanizing offers superior corrosion resistance—a must in Uganda's humid climate. Recent data shows galvanized steel brackets last 2–3 times longer than alternatives in tropical conditions (see table below).
| Material | Lifespan (Years) | Maintenance Cost |
|---|---|---|
| Hot Dip Galvanized Steel | 25–30 | Low |
| Painted Steel | 8–12 | High |
| Aluminum | 15–20 | Medium |
Industry Trends Driving Demand
The shift toward floating solar farms and modular designs has reshaped bracket requirements. For example, Uganda's 10 MW Kabulasoke Solar Plant uses custom galvanized brackets to withstand lakebed conditions. Meanwhile, factories are adopting AI-driven quality control systems to meet international certifications like ISO 1461.
Case Study: Rural Electrification Success
In 2023, a Uganda-based factory supplied 15,000 galvanized brackets for a USAID-funded project. Result? A 40% reduction in installation time and zero corrosion-related failures after 18 months. Projects like this prove why localized manufacturing matters.
